Перейти к содержимому


Добавить Кнопку Подробнее


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 30

#1 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 21 Август 2016 - 19:30

Добавить кнопку подробнее с заходом в товар в том же стиле. Скриншот прилагаю Аккаунт SL-387361

Прикрепленные изображения

  • 1.png


#2 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 21 Август 2016 - 20:08

Просмотр сообщенияTeraweb (21 Август 2016 - 19:30) писал:

Добавить кнопку подробнее с заходом в товар в том же стиле. Скриншот прилагаю Аккаунт SL-387361

В шаблоне Товары код:
							<!-- END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
						  </li>

Заменил на:
							<!-- END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
						  </li>
						  <a class="info button" href="{goods.URL | url_amp}"><span>Подробнее</span><i class="fa fa-info-circle"></i></a>

В main.css код:
.products-list .item .product-shop .actions .info {float: left;display: inline-block;font-size: 16px;color: #909090;border: 1px solid #e5e5e5;padding: 0;background-color: transparent;margin-right: 10px;}
.products-list .item .product-shop .actions .info span {padding: 0 10px;}
.products-list .item .product-shop .actions .info .fa {margin-right: -1px;}

Заменил на:
.products-list .item .product-shop .actions .add-cart {float: left;display: inline-block;font-size: 16px;color: #909090;border: 1px solid #e5e5e5;padding: 0;background-color: transparent;margin-right: 10px;}
.products-list .item .product-shop .actions .add-cart span {padding: 0 10px;}
.products-list .item .product-shop .actions .add-cart .fa {margin-right: -1px;}
.products-list .item .product-shop .actions .info {float: left;display: inline-block;font-size: 16px;color: #909090;border: 1px solid #e5e5e5;padding: 0;background-color: transparent;margin-right: 10px;}
.products-list .item .product-shop .actions .info span {padding: 0 10px;}
.products-list .item .product-shop .actions .info .fa {margin-right: -1px;}

Проверьте, пожалуйста.

#3 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 21 Август 2016 - 20:12

Спасибо. А сделайте еще, так же, что бы кнопка при наведение меняла цвет как В КОРЗИНУ. Спасибо.

#4 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 21 Август 2016 - 20:22

Просмотр сообщенияTeraweb (21 Август 2016 - 20:12) писал:

Спасибо. А сделайте еще, так же, что бы кнопка при наведение меняла цвет как В КОРЗИНУ. Спасибо.

После строчки:
.products-list .item .product-shop .actions .info .fa {margin-right: -1px;}

Добавил строку:
.products-list .item .product-shop .actions .info:hover {background: #09afe7;color: #fff;}


#5 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 21 Август 2016 - 20:24

Ну просто спасибо огромное.

#6 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 22 Август 2016 - 01:11

А есть возможность, что бы в кратком описании внесенная информация с новой строки, тоже отображалась с новой строки?

#7 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 22 Август 2016 - 10:42

Просмотр сообщенияTeraweb (22 Август 2016 - 01:11) писал:

А есть возможность, что бы в кратком описании внесенная информация с новой строки, тоже отображалась с новой строки?

Здравствуйте.
Для краткого описания товаров в категориях:
Зайдите в админ. панель -> Сайт -> Редактор шаблонов -> Шаблоны -> Товары, найдите код:
					<div class="desc">
					  <p itemprop="description">{goods.DESCRIPTION_SHORT}</p>
					</div>

Замените на:
					<div class="desc">
					  <p itemprop="description">{goods.DESCRIPTION_SHORT | htmlspecialchars_decode}</p>
					</div>

Для краткого описания в карточке товара:
Зайдите в админ. панель -> Сайт -> Редактор шаблонов -> Шаблоны -> Товар, найдите код:
	  <!-- Краткое описание -->
	  <div class="short-description f-fix">
		<p itemprop="description">{GOODS_DESCRIPTION_SHORT}</p>
	  </div>

Замените на:
	  <!-- Краткое описание -->
	  <div class="short-description f-fix">
		<p itemprop="description">{GOODS_DESCRIPTION_SHORT | htmlspecialchars_decode}</p>
	  </div>


#8 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 25 Август 2016 - 14:06

Не изменилось ничего.
Как последний пункт каталога сделать ссылкой на нужный мне адрес?

#9 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 25 Август 2016 - 14:46

Просмотр сообщенияTeraweb (25 Август 2016 - 14:06) писал:

Не изменилось ничего.
Как последний пункт каталога сделать ссылкой на нужный мне адрес?

Здравствуйте.
После выполнения предыдущей инструкции - чтобы строки переносились нужно будет в месте переноса в описании добавить код <br>, например:
Пункты с переносом:<br>
1 пункт<br>
2 пункт<br>
3 пункт

Для задания ссылки на последний пункт меню каталога (в левом блоке) в шаблоне HTML найдите код:
				<div class="block-menu-content">
				  <ul>
					{% FOR catalog_full %}
					  {% IF catalog_full.FIRST %}{% IFNOT catalog_full.LEVEL = 0 %}<ul class="sub">{% ENDIF %}{% ENDIF %}
						<li {% IF catalog_full.HIDE %}style="display:none;"{% ENDIF %} class="{% IF catalog_full.ISSET_SUB %}parent{% ENDIF %} {% IF catalog_full.LEVEL = 0 %}subhead{% ENDIF %} {% IF catalog_full.CURRENT || catalog_full.CURRENT_PARENT %}active{% ENDIF %}">
						  <a href="{catalog_full.URL}" {% IF catalog_full.CURRENT %}class="active"{% ENDIF %}>{% IF catalog_full.ISSET_SUB %}<span class="open-sub {% IF catalog_full.CURRENT_PARENT || catalog_full.CURRENT %}active{% ENDIF %}"></span>{% ENDIF %}{catalog_full.NAME}</a>
						{% IF catalog_full.ISSET_SUB=0 %}</li>{% ENDIF %}
						{% IF catalog_full.LAST %}{%FOR out%}</ul>{%IFNOT catalog_full.out.LAST%}</li>{%ENDIF%}{%ENDFOR%}{% ENDIF %}
					{% ENDFOR %}
				  </ul>
				 
				</div>

Замените на:
				<div class="block-menu-content">
				  <ul>
					{% FOR catalog_full %}
					  {% IF catalog_full.FIRST %}{% IFNOT catalog_full.LEVEL = 0 %}<ul class="sub">{% ENDIF %}{% ENDIF %}
						<li {% IF catalog_full.HIDE %}style="display:none;"{% ENDIF %} class="{% IF catalog_full.ISSET_SUB %}parent{% ENDIF %} {% IF catalog_full.LEVEL = 0 %}subhead{% ENDIF %} {% IF catalog_full.CURRENT || catalog_full.CURRENT_PARENT %}active{% ENDIF %}">
						  <a {% IF catalog_full.NAME=Строительство бассейнов %}href="ссылка на страницу"{% ELSE %}href="{catalog_full.URL}"{% ENDIF %} {% IF catalog_full.CURRENT %}class="active"{% ENDIF %}>{% IF catalog_full.ISSET_SUB %}<span class="open-sub {% IF catalog_full.CURRENT_PARENT || catalog_full.CURRENT %}active{% ENDIF %}"></span>{% ENDIF %}{catalog_full.NAME}</a>
						{% IF catalog_full.ISSET_SUB=0 %}</li>{% ENDIF %}
						{% IF catalog_full.LAST %}{%FOR out%}</ul>{%IFNOT catalog_full.out.LAST%}</li>{%ENDIF%}{%ENDFOR%}{% ENDIF %}
					{% ENDFOR %}
				  </ul>
				 
				</div>
Где укажите ссылку на страницу вместо ссылка на страницу

#10 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 25 Август 2016 - 15:07

По краткому описанию Спасибо. С ссылкой не получилось.

#11 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 25 Август 2016 - 15:35

Просмотр сообщенияTeraweb (25 Август 2016 - 15:07) писал:

По краткому описанию Спасибо. С ссылкой не получилось.

Вы по ошибке заменили код вывода Меню вместо аналогичного блока (но с другим содержимым) для каталога.
Вернул Вам блок меню к стандартному виду и выполнил инструкцию.
Теперь остается заменить ссылку в коде:
												  <a {% IF catalog_full.NAME=Строительство бассейнов %}href="ссылка на страницу"{% ELSE %}href="{catalog_full.URL}"{% ENDIF %} {% IF catalog_full.CURRENT %}class="active"{% ENDIF %}>{% IF catalog_full.ISSET_SUB %}<span class="open-sub {% IF catalog_full.CURRENT_PARENT || catalog_full.CURRENT %}active{% ENDIF %}"></span>{% ENDIF %}{catalog_full.NAME}</a>


#12 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 25 Август 2016 - 15:42

Просмотр сообщенияFirefly (25 Август 2016 - 15:35) писал:

Вы по ошибке заменили код вывода Меню вместо аналогичного блока (но с другим содержимым) для каталога.
Вернул Вам блок меню к стандартному виду и выполнил инструкцию.
Теперь остается заменить ссылку в коде:
												 <a {% IF catalog_full.NAME=Строительство бассейнов %}href="ссылка на страницу"{% ELSE %}href="{catalog_full.URL}"{% ENDIF %} {% IF catalog_full.CURRENT %}class="active"{% ENDIF %}>{% IF catalog_full.ISSET_SUB %}<span class="open-sub {% IF catalog_full.CURRENT_PARENT || catalog_full.CURRENT %}active{% ENDIF %}"></span>{% ENDIF %}{catalog_full.NAME}</a>
Спасибо. Еще вопрос. Как на слайдер добавить ссылки?

#13 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 25 Август 2016 - 17:53

Поможете?

#14 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 25 Август 2016 - 17:57

Просмотр сообщенияTeraweb (25 Август 2016 - 15:42) писал:

Спасибо. Еще вопрос. Как на слайдер добавить ссылки?

Поскольку Ваш слайдер изначально не предусматривал установку ссылок на изображения - потребовалось переписать код, теперь ссылки на изображения необходимо будет добавлять в шаблоне HTML в коде:
		 <!-- Slider Слайдер -->
		 {% IF index_page %}
			 <div class="jR3DCarouselGallery">
			 <div class="jR3DCarouselCustomSlide"><a href="#"><img src="/design/slide1.jpg" /></a>
				 <!--<div class="jR3DCarouselCaption">This is custom caption 1</div>-->
			 </div>
			 <div class="jR3DCarouselCustomSlide"><a href="#"><img src="/design/slide2.jpg" /></a>
				 <!--<div class="jR3DCarouselCaption">This is custom caption 2</div>-->
			 </div>
			 <div class="jR3DCarouselCustomSlide"><a href="#"><img src="/design/slide6.jpg" /></a>
				 <!--<div class="jR3DCarouselCaption">This is custom caption 3</div>-->
			 </div>
			 <div class="jR3DCarouselCustomSlide"><a href="#"><img src="/design/slide7.jpg" /></a>
				 <!--<div class="jR3DCarouselCaption">This is custom caption 4</div>-->
			 </div>
			 </div>
		 {% ENDIF %}
		 <!-- /END Slider Слайдер -->

Здесь же Вы можете установить ссылки вместо # для соответствующих картинок.

#15 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 25 Август 2016 - 20:36

Спасибо огромное

#16 Teraweb

Teraweb

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 250 сообщений

Отправлено 25 Август 2016 - 20:55

А здесь сделайте тоже кнопку Подробнее так же.Аккаунт SL-391742

#17 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 26 Август 2016 - 04:29

В шаблоне Товары после:
{% ELSE %}
							  <a class="add-compare"
								data-action-is-add="1"
								data-action-add-url="{COMPARE_ADD_URL}"
								data-action-delete-url="{COMPARE_DELETE_URL}"
								data-action-add-title="Добавить &laquo;{goods.NAME}&raquo; в список сравнения с другими товарами"
								data-action-delete-title="Убрать &laquo;{goods.NAME}&raquo; из списка сравнения с другими товарами"
								data-prodname="{goods.NAME}"
								data-produrl="{goods.URL}"
								data-id="{goods.ID}"
								data-mod-id="{goods.MIN_PRICE_NOW_ID}"
								title="Добавить &laquo;{goods.NAME}&raquo; в список сравнения с другими товарами"
								href="{COMPARE_ADD_URL}?id={goods.MIN_PRICE_NOW_ID}&amp;from={goods.GOODS_FROM}&amp;return_to={CURRENT_URL | urlencode}"
							  ><i class="fa fa-retweet"></i></a>
							{% ENDIF %}
						  {% ENDIF %}
						  <!-- END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
						</li>

вставьте:
<li><a class="info button" href="{goods.URL | url_amp}"><span>Подробнее</span><i class="fa fa-info-circle"></i></a></li>


#18 aleff

aleff

    Продвинутый пользователь

  • Пользователи
  • PipPipPip
  • 185 сообщений

Отправлено 23 Сентябрь 2016 - 10:10

При выводе товара списком, как вернуть стиль кнопки в корзину и подробнее по умолчанию
Аккаунт SL-211250

#19 Mr.Nito

Mr.Nito

    Активный участник

  • Модераторы
  • 1 364 сообщений

Отправлено 23 Сентябрь 2016 - 10:21

Просмотр сообщенияaleff (23 Сентябрь 2016 - 10:10) писал:

При выводе товара списком, как вернуть стиль кнопки в корзину и подробнее по умолчанию
Аккаунт SL-211250
Здравствуйте.
В редакторе шаблонов - Товары
(строка 281)
замените
<button type="submit" class="add-cart button" title="Положить &laquo;{GOODS_NAME}&raquo; в корзину">В корзину</button>
на
<button type="submit" class="add-cart button" title="Положить &laquo;{GOODS_NAME}&raquo; в корзину">В корзину<i class="fa fa-shopping-cart"></i></button>


#20 aleff

aleff

    Продвинутый пользователь

  • Пользователи
  • PipPipPip
  • 185 сообщений

Отправлено 23 Сентябрь 2016 - 10:26

Назначение изменилось, а стиль нет




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ных